Table 3.

Baseline mean arterial pressure (MAP) and heart rate (HR), bradycardic and tachycardic peak and sympathetic (SBG) and parasympathetic baroreflex gain (PBG) in Wistar Kyoto rats exposed to SSCS and treated with ATZ administered into the 4th V. N = 7. Mean±SEM. *p<0.05 for comparison with 0′.

Variable 0′ 5′ 15′ 30′ 60′
MAP (mmHg) 106±13 118±14 111±15 107±12 107±13
HR (bpm) 344±16 412±19* 440±13* 429±17* 397±13
Bradycardic Peak (bpm) 279±14 323±19 364±26* 380±18* 318±10
Tachycardic Peak (bpm) 489±11 506±18 525±19 527±14 502±12
HR range (bpm) 203±12 183±13 161±22 169±25 183±11
PBG (bpm x mmHg-1) -1.2±0.34 -1.19±0.11 -1.08±0.22 -0.85±0.13 -1.11±0.19
SBG (bpm x mmHg-1) -1.48±0.2 -1.26±0.14 -1.39±0.26 -1.13±0.1 -1.84±0.21
